Package | Description |
---|---|
org.maltparser.core.symbol.trie |
Provides classes for handling different kinds of symbols as trie data structure.
|
Modifier and Type | Method and Description |
---|---|
TrieSymbolTable |
TrieSymbolTableHandler.addSymbolTable(java.lang.String tableName) |
TrieSymbolTable |
TrieSymbolTableHandler.addSymbolTable(java.lang.String tableName,
int columnCategory,
int columnType,
java.lang.String nullValueStrategy) |
TrieSymbolTable |
TrieSymbolTableHandler.addSymbolTable(java.lang.String tableName,
SymbolTable parentTable) |
TrieSymbolTable |
TrieSymbolTableHandler.getSymbolTable(java.lang.String tableName) |
Modifier and Type | Method and Description |
---|---|
TrieNode |
Trie.addValue(java.lang.StringBuilder symbol,
TrieSymbolTable table,
int code) |
TrieNode |
Trie.addValue(java.lang.String value,
TrieSymbolTable table,
int code) |
java.lang.Integer |
Trie.getEntry(java.lang.String value,
TrieSymbolTable table) |
java.lang.Integer |
TrieNode.getEntry(TrieSymbolTable table)
Returns the entry of the symbol table 'table'
|
TrieNode |
TrieNode.getOrAddChild(boolean isWord,
char c,
TrieSymbolTable table,
int code)
Adds and/or retrieve a child trie node.
|
java.lang.String |
Trie.getValue(TrieNode node,
TrieSymbolTable table) |
Copyright 2007-2017 Johan Hall, Jens Nilsson and Joakim Nivre.